 Job Title: Accountant

Location: Remote

Employment Type: Full-time Job Summary

We are seeking to engage a diligent, detail-oriented, and commercially aware Accountant to manage the company's financial operations. The successful candidate will be responsible for maintaining accurate financial records, managing payroll, tax compliance, client invoicing, project cost tracking, and providing timely financial reports to management. This role is critical to ensuring financial discipline as the company scales its operations across multiple service lines.


Key Responsibilities

Maintain accurate and up-to-date financial records and prepare monthly, quarterly, and annual financial reports. Manage accounts payable and receivable, including vendor payments, staff expense claims, and client invoicing. Process payroll and ensure timely remittance of statutory deductions, including PAYE, Pension, NSITF, and NHF. Manage tax compliance, including CIT, VAT, and WHT filings, while ensuring adherence to relevant regulations. Track project costs against budgets, prepare job cost reports, and highlight variances for management review. Perform bank reconciliations, manage petty cash and cash flow, maintain financial controls and documentation, and support budgeting, audits, and financial planning.


Requirements

Bachelor's Degree in Accounting, Finance, Economics, or a related field. ICAN, ACA, or ACCA qualification (or student membership with proven progression for junior candidates). 2–4 years' relevant accounting experience. Experience in engineering, construction, oil & gas, or other project-based organisations is an added advantage. Proficiency in Sage, QuickBooks, or similar accounting software, with strong Microsoft Excel skills. Good knowledge of Nigerian tax laws and statutory compliance.
